What is Laminate Flooring?

Laminate flooring is a layered synthetic product made to resemble wood, tile, or stone. It includes a protective top layer, a decorative image layer, a high-density fiberboard (HDF) core, and a stabilizing backing layer. Its interlocking design makes it a popular choice for both DIY and professional installations in Pakistani homes.

Is Laminate Flooring Suitable for Pakistani Homes?

Yes, in many cases. Laminate flooring is widely used in bedrooms, lounges, and upper floors in cities like Islamabad, Rawalpindi, and Lahore. It offers a balance between cost, appearance, and practicality. However, it’s not ideal for wet areas or homes with frequent water exposure.

✅ Pros of Laminate Flooring

  • Budget-Friendly: Costs less than solid hardwood and imported tiles.
  • Easy to Install: Most brands use a click-lock system that requires no glue or nails.
  • Low Maintenance: Regular dry mopping keeps it clean. It doesn’t need polishing.
  • Scratch Resistant: Holds up well against everyday wear, especially in AC3 or higher ratings.
  • Style Variety: Comes in countless woodgrain textures, stone patterns, and shades.

⚠️ Cons of Laminate Flooring

  • Not Waterproof: Spills or leaks can damage the fiberboard core.
  • Hard to Repair: Unlike real wood, you can’t refinish or sand it.
  • Feels Less Natural: It doesn’t have the warmth or character of real wood underfoot.
  • Sun Fading: Prolonged exposure to sunlight can cause fading in certain areas.

Where to Use Laminate Flooring

Room Recommended?
Living Room ✔️ Great option, especially with rugs
Bedrooms ✔️ Warm and comfortable underfoot
Kitchen ❌ Not ideal due to moisture
Bathrooms ❌ Avoid completely
Upper Floors ✔️ Lightweight and sound-reducing

Tips for Choosing the Right Laminate

  • Pick at least AC3-rated laminate for residential use.
  • If you have pets or kids, consider scratch-resistant coatings.
  • Choose a shade that complements your interior — lighter colors for small rooms, darker tones for a cozy look.

Maintenance Guide

Maintenance is simple but important:

  • Use a dry mop or vacuum for daily cleaning.
  • Wipe spills immediately with a dry cloth.
  • Avoid wet mops and steam cleaners — moisture can warp the boards.
  • Use felt pads under furniture to prevent scratching.
